DOT compliance requirements for John Brown & Sons Inc

Based on this carrier's registration profile, these federal requirements apply:

USDOT registration and MCS-150 biennial update

Every registered carrier must keep its MCS-150 filing current and update it at least every two years. Missing the biennial update window can deactivate USDOT number 288626. Check this company's MCS-150 deadline

Driver qualification files

With 30 drivers on record, this carrier must maintain a complete DQ file for each driver: applications, MVRs, medical certificates and road test records. DQ file services

Drug & Alcohol testing and FMCSA Clearinghouse

Carriers with CDL drivers (16 reported) must run a compliant DOT drug and alcohol testing program and complete annual Clearinghouse queries for every driver. Clearinghouse services

Hours of service and ELD

As an interstate operation, drivers are subject to federal hours-of-service limits and, in most cases, electronic logging device requirements. ELD & HOS support

Vehicle maintenance files and annual inspections

With 34 power units, each vehicle needs systematic maintenance records and a documented annual DOT inspection. Fleet maintenance compliance
